Hi there, I am Özgün Özerk

a Rust Developer, with a masters degree on Cryptography.

Here, I will be explaining various complex topics on Cryptography, Blockchains, and the Math behind them, in basic plain English. So that, everyone can understand! For free!

I. Consensus

I. Consensus

Blockchain In Plain English
II. Ordering

II. Ordering

Blockchain In Plain English
III. Proof of Work

III. Proof of Work

Blockchain In Plain English
I. Intro

I. Intro

Every Intuition Behind Fourier Transform
II. Decomposing Signals

II. Decomposing Signals

Every Intuition Behind Fourier Transform
III. The Formula

III. The Formula

Every Intuition Behind Fourier Transform

KZG Polynomial Commitments

Constant proof size for commitments

Özgün Özerk
Özgün Özerk

Centralized vs. Decentralized Systems

A Detailed Comparison Between Centralized and Decentralized Systems

Özgün Özerk
Özgün Özerk

(Cryptographic) Hash Functions

Properties And Intricacies of Cryptographic Hash Functions

Özgün Özerk
Özgün Özerk

Sized & Dynamic Dispatching

Returning different types from a function

Özgün Özerk
Özgün Özerk

Pin & Unpin

Things that shouldn't move in Rust

Özgün Özerk
Özgün Özerk

Unsafe Rust

Modifying a vector in place without locks

Özgün Özerk
Özgün Özerk

Get in touch

If you want to contact me, feel free to send a connection request from LinkedIn. I'm friendly :)